Farmers’ anger forces Sampla to return

Phagwara, July 24

As soon as the news of the arrival of former Union Minister and National SC Commission chairman Vijay Sampla spread, irate farmers gathered at the spot where he was to inaugurate a showroom at Satnampura in Phagwara on Saturday.

BJP leader Balbhadhar Sein Duggal had opened a new sanitary showroom, which was to be inaugurated by Sampla, but on hearing the news, farmers got provoked and started gathering under the banner of Bhartiya Kisan Union, Doaba. They started raising slogans 100 meters away from the venue and warned that they would not allow BJP leaders to work until the Union Government solved their problem.

The protest took an ugly turn so much that farmers and BJP leaders came face to face and started tearing down the tents set up for the function. Though SP Phagwara Sarabjit Singh Wahia, DSP Paramjit Singh, DSP Babandeep Singh were present with a posse of police, farmers insisted that they had come to oppose the chairman and the farmers would return only after removing the tents. The police tried stopping both sides, but to no avail.

Meanwhile, Senior Superintendent of the Police, Kapurthala, Harkamalpreet Singh Khakh, reached and spoke to both parties and farmers’ leaders who were adamant on taking down the tents. Some farmers were adamant but farmers ended their dharna after a message from Satnam Singh Sahni, general secretary, Bhartiya Kisan Union, Doaba.

Farmers, however, warned that now wherever BJP leaders would go for ceremonies or inaugurations, they would be strongly opposed. Meanwhile, it was learnt that Sampla was forced to return from a short distance from the venue without inaugurating the shop on the advice of senior cops.
